Web9 apr. 2024 · Your pot is £60,000. If you take £1,000 out as cash every month. £250 (25% of £1,000) will tax-free every time. The remaining £750 will be taxable each time. Any taxable money you take from your pension will be added to your other income for that year and taxed at the relevant income tax band.

The Spring Budget has also raised the annual allowance for pension savings from £40,000 to £60,000. The annual allowance is the maximum amount you can contribute to your pension each year, and still enjoy full tax benefits.
